The Final Frontier (a Pathfinder RPG campaign for 21st-level characters): In the wake of the Gnollwar, the land has returned to a relatively stable condition. But now a greater battle is brewing, the race across the planes to gain the power of God Himself. . . .

The Gnoll Patrol (a completed 3rd-Edition D&D campaign for 1st-ECL characters): In the year 169, heroes working for the Silver Axe adventuring company fought against the gnolls mustering their forces in the Teeth. Sadly, their efforts were in vain, and the beasts overran all civilization in the range. [The log for this campaign can be found here.]

The Gnollwar (a Pathfinder RPG campaign for 8th-ECL characters): Having conquered the mountains, the gnoll horde advances into the low-lying Empire of Altan. Can the forces of good stop their rampage? [We started playing this in D&D v.3.5, but scheduling didn’t work out, so it was put on indefinite hold. The 8th-level point is where we would pick up.]

Mongrel Gulch (a Pathfinder RPG campaign for 1st?-ECL characters): Between the Teeth, a land controlled by barbaric gnolls; and the Wake, an authoritarian, fiend-worshiping empire; lies a small settlement of outcasts. Consisting of a melting pot of various cultures and those in-between them, the town is in need of law enforcement officers to keep the peace. Thus, the new administration puts out a call for deputies to clean up the town.

“Talisman” (a Pathfinder RPG adventure for ?-ECL characters): When a mysterious patroness hires adventurers to acquire a magic item, what is her real motive?
